Protein-protein interaction & protein complex analysis

This analysis interrogates either which proteins interact with which ones, or how many and which proteins interacte in a protein complex. The Proteomics and Metabolomics Facility offers two different workflows with different technologies to do these analyses:

  1.  DSSO-based cross-linking mass spectrometry (XL-MS) for protein-protein interactions and protein complex to determine the identities and spatial orientations of interacting proteins simultaneously by freezing transient interactions through the formation of covalent bonds.
  2. Immuno-precipitation pulldown to specific lure protein and its protein interacting complex, followed-up by either in-gel or in-solution protein identification to figure out which proteins are uniquely present under treated conditions over controls.

Analyses of protein-protein complex can quantitatively compare two groups (e.g. wild type and mutant), and explore what protein interactions have changed between the two groups.
